Watchmaking Operator (M/F)
Job Description:
Regularly mandated by various Manufactures in the region, we are constantly seeking experienced profiles in Watchmaking for movement components.
You carry out various manual operations or on small semi-automatic machines (decoration, filling, deburring, washing, microblasting, etc...)
You supply the production machines and load the programmes according to the series.
You perform self-inspection of your production and report non-conformities.
Job Requirements:
You have recent experience in Watchmaking on small components.
The tasks require good eyesight as well as excellent dexterity.
You are comfortable with computer tools.
You are available immediately.
Shift work in 2x8 hours.
You have your own transport.
